This drama was a monumental production for its time. The budget for "Yeon Gaesomun" was an astonishing 40 billion South Korean won (approximately $40 million USD at the time), making it one of the most expensive Korean dramas ever produced up to that point. The money was spent on elaborate sets, massive battle sequences, period-accurate costumes, and a large cast of extras. The series was created by SBS and produced by DSP ENT, a production company known for handling large-scale projects.
